I finished checking my boxes for the year on the pet trail at Highbanks Metro Park this morning (another sign of Fall) and at one point, ran into a flock of 8 or more Blue-gray Gnatcatchers. As I continued to follow the flock along the tree line, I was rewarded with a single male and female Blackburnian warbler and a single male Canada warbler. They quickly dispersed and I did not see another warbler for the remainder of my walk. There were also good numbers of flycatchers all morning - Eastern Wood Pewees and Willow Flycatchers.
